I read about the 23 in 2023 challenge half way through last year and decided I’d have a go at the 24 in 2024 challenge. I’m posting this really to keep me on track and to have some kind of accountability. If you want to have a go yourself, just choose 24 things that you’d like to accomplish in 2024. They don’t have to be about self improvement and could be about any area of life. I’m not viewing it like the usual new year’s resolutions that are all too easily broken within a couple of weeks, but more a list of things I’d like to achieve, mostly as a form of self care. It’s very easy to forget yourself when life starts getting a bit tough, so a written reminder, should help along the way.

Here are my 24 aims for 2024. Some will be easy for me, others not so:

  1. Walk 24 miles a week.

  2. Do 24 minutes of exercise a day (including yoga, qigong, but excluding walking).

  3. Swim 24 times during the year.

  4. Do 24 minutes of brain training at least 4 times a week.

  5. Practise 24 mins of mindfulness or guided meditation at least once a week.

  6. Visit 24 new places.

  7. Go out for the day/evening 24 times.

  8. Socialise 24 times.

  9. Read 24 books stored on my Kindle.

  10. Read 24 paperbacks from my bookshelf.

  11. Read 24 new books.

  12. Create 24 pieces of art.

  13. Watch 24 films.

  14. Leave 24 reviews online.

  15. Donate to charity 24 times/ do 24 random acts of kindness.

  16. Give 24 things away.

  17. Message 24 Facebook friends that I don’t see very often.

  18. Have 24 chatty phone calls.

  19. Send 24 cards or letters.

  20. Look up the meaning of 24 words I don’t know.

  21. Upload 24 photos a month to Instagram for photo of the day challenges.

  22. Have at least 24 portions of different fruit and veg per week.

  23. Play 24 old albums that I haven’t listened to in years.

  24. Spend 24 hours a year blogging
